What you will be doing:

  • Develop a large-scale reinforcement learning training framework capable of running on thousands of GPUs;

  • Build and optimize simulation infrastructure (based on GPU-accelerated simulators like Isaac Lab) to support the training of locomotion and manipulation policies for robots at scale;

  • Develop sim-to-real transfer pipelines and work closely with the robotics team to deploy to physical robots;

  • Propose scalable solutions that combine LLMs with policy learning. Example work:;

  • Apply reinforcement learning to finetune multimodal LLMs.

What we need to see:

  • Bachelor’s degree or above in Computer Science, Robotics, Engineering, or a related field;

  • 5+ years of industry experience on large-scale deep learning or MLOps;

  • Exceptional engineering skills in building, testing, and maintaining scalable distributed GPU training frameworks;

  • Proficiency in Python. Hands-on model training experience in PyTorch, JAX, or Tensorflow;

  • Deep familiarity with reinforcement learning algorithms like PPO, SAC, or Q-learning, including experience tuning hyperparameters and reward functions;

  • Familiarity with common policy learning techniques like reward shaping, domain randomization, curriculum learning;

  • Strong experience with large-scale GPU clusters, HPC environments, and jobscheduling/orchestrationtools (e.g., SLURM, Kubernetes).


Ways to stand out from the crowd:

  • Master’s or PhD’s degree in Computer Science, Robotics, Engineering, or a related field;

  • Demonstrated experience transferring policies from simulation to real robots for locomotion and manipulation;

  • Contributions to popular open-source reinforcement learning frameworks or research publications in top-tier AI conferences, such as NeurIPS, ICRA, ICLR, CoRL;

  • Strong ability to mentor junior engineers or researchers and lead technical projects from conception to completion.
